PQShield and Carahsoft Partner to Make Powerful Post-Quantum Cryptography Solutions Available to Government Agencies

PQShield has partnered with Carahsoft Technology Corp. to deliver advanced secured quantum services to Government agencies across the United States. This strategic collaboration makes PQShield’s post-quantum cryptography solutions more accessible to Federal, State and Local organisations, as well as educational institutions.

By combining PQShield’s expertise in quantum-safe cryptography with Carahsoft’s public sector distribution network, Government customers can now accelerate their transition to quantum-ready security.

Expanding Access to Secured Quantum Services

Through this partnership, Carahsoft will serve as PQShield’s Master Government Aggregator®, simplifying procurement and enabling streamlined access to secured quantum services.

This means our NIST PQC Standards-compliant solutions can now be accessed via key contracts including:

  • NASA Solutions for Enterprise-Wide Procurement (SEWP) V
  • OMNIA Partners
  • E&I Cooperative Services Contract
  • The Quilt

These established contract vehicles ensure that agencies can efficiently procure PQShield’s post-quantum cryptography solutions without unnecessary delays.

Supporting the 2035 Quantum Deadline

“We are pleased to partner with Carahsoft to help Government customers transition to post-quantum cryptography by 2035 to meet the deadline set by national cybersecurity agencies like the NSA” said Ben Packman, Chief Strategy Officer, PQShield.

“With the release of the NIST standards, we’ve reached a critical milestone in advancing post-quantum security. Post-quantum cryptography is already making its way through the supply chain, and quantum-safe, NIST-aligned products are available today. To accelerate adoption, we not only need continued development but also greater education and clear guidance for enterprises on what these standards mean and how they affect their security responsibilities. Given that Government agencies and critical national infrastructure will likely be among the first targets of quantum-enabled threats, it is essential to collaborate with partners like Carahsoft to help these institutions navigate the transition to post-quantum readiness.”
